fix pr/45972
[official-gcc.git] / gcc / testsuite / gfortran.dg / c_loc_tests_7.f03
blob78f5276bdefc2d85a9e6c3df9cb81e2892659369
1 ! { dg-do compile }
2 module c_loc_tests_7
3 use iso_c_binding
4 contains
5 SUBROUTINE glutInit_f03()
6   TYPE(C_PTR), DIMENSION(1), TARGET :: argv=C_NULL_PTR
7   CHARACTER(C_CHAR), DIMENSION(1), TARGET :: empty_string=C_NULL_CHAR
8   argv(1)=C_LOC(empty_string)
9 END SUBROUTINE
10 end module c_loc_tests_7
11 ! { dg-final { cleanup-modules "c_loc_tests_7" } }